Preparation
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9x5 inch loaf pan.
- In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, granulated sugar, brown sugar, baking soda,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t until well combined.
- Add in the eggs and vegetable oil; stir gently until just combined—avoid overmixing.
- Fold in the grated carrots and nuts if using; ensure the batter is thick but not dry.
-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and bake for 50-60 minutes or until a toothpick inserted comes out clean.
- Allow the loaf to cool for 10 minutes in the pan before transferring to a wire rack.
- Once completely cooled, prepare the cream cheese frosting by whipping together the cream cheese and powdered sugar until smooth. Frost generously on top of the loaf.

Notes
Feel free to swap in your favorite nuts or dried fruits for added texture. For a vegan twist, substitute eggs with applesauce and use a plant-based cream for the frosting.
